DM9000: Fixup blackfin after removing 2 resource usage

The dm9000 driver accepts either 2 or 3 resources to describe the platform
devices. The 2 resources case abuses the ioresource mechanism by passing
ioremap()ed memory through the platform device resources. This patch removes
converts boards that were using it to the 3 resources scheme.
